Requirements
  • Current nursing license to practice in the state where the employee provides service.
  • Current driver's license in the state of residence and possession of a registered and insured motor vehicle.
  • Two years of experience working in an acute care setting.
  • Graduation from an accredited school of nursing.
Responsibilities
  • Respond to and visit patients referred for admission to Calvary @ Home.
  • Inform patients, caregivers, and family members about available hospice services and assess patients for admission.
  • Visit Calvary @ Home patients who have been admitted to the hospital and communicate patient status with the respective interdisciplinary team.
  • Develop relationships with hospitals, physicians, nursing facilities, and other referral sources through outreach, education, and networking.
  • Educate patients and caregivers about hospice, evaluate eligibility, and work with the interdisciplinary team to develop an initial plan of care using hospice and palliative care principles.
  • Generate and respond to referrals from hospitals and other community partners.
  • Work with physicians and the interdisciplinary team.
  • Travel on weekends.
Desired Qualifications
  • One year of hospice experience.
  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ing preferred.

Calvary Hospital provides palliative and hospice care for terminally ill adults, including those with advanced cancer, with inpatient facilities in the Bronx, Brooklyn, Manhattan and Queens and Home Care and Hospice Services across the greater New York area. Care comes from multidisciplinary teams that offer round-the-clock symptom relief, comfort, and emotional and spiritual support in hospitals and extend that care into patients’ homes through Home Care and Hospice services. Founded in 1899, the hospital is described as an international model for palliative and end-of-life care, guided by the values of compassion, non-abandonment, dignity, and love, with a broad geographic footprint and integrated inpatient and community services. The goal is to improve quality of life for patients and to support families, aiming to be a leading international model for end-of-life care.

What makes Calvary Hospital unique

  • Calvary Hospital is New York’s only fully accredited adult palliative-care specialty hospital.
  • Founded in 1899, it serves more than 6,000 patients annually across five boroughs.
  • Its Morris Park campus offers end-of-life care with family-centered spaces and grief programs.
